(U21449 Maple Road, Rubery) (Temporary Closure) Order 2024

Proposed Order: To close that part of U21449 Maple Road from its junction with U2M52 Maple Road for a distance of 50 metres in a southerly direction (between numbers 10 and 24).

Reason: Installation of dropped kerb by WCC.

Exemptions: To permit access to any land or premises fronting the highway affected where there is no other form of access; and to allow the works to be undertaken.

Alternative route: U21449 Maple Road, U21452 Maple Road and vice versa.

(U22206 Sheltwood Lane, Tardebigge) (Temporary Closure) Order 2024

Proposed Order: To close that part of U22206 Sheltwood Lane from 1,000 metres south of its junction with U22206 London Lane for a distance of 335 metres in an Easterly direction.

Reason: Drainage/flood alleviation by WCC.

Exemptions: To permit access to any land or premises fronting the highway affected where there is no other form of access; and to allow the works to be undertaken.

Alternative route: U22206 Sheltwood Lane (part), U22207 High House Lane, B4184 Alcester Road, C2045

Holyoakes Lane, C2045 Copyholt Lane, U22206 Sheltwood Lane (part) and vice versa.

Maximum duration: 18 Months. Anticipated duration: 5 days. Commencing: 29 April 2024.

(U22024 Foley Gardens, Stoke Prior) (Temporary Closure) Order 2024

Proposed Order: To close that part of U22024 Foley Gardens from its most northerly junction with B4091 Hanbury Road to its most southerly junction with B4091 Hanbury Road.

Reason: New customer connection by Cadent Gas Ltd.

Exemptions: To permit access to any land or premises fronting the highway affected where there is no other

form of access; and to allow the works to be undertaken.

Alternative route: B4091 Hanbury Road and vice versa.

Maximum duration: 18 Months. Anticipated duration: 5 days. Commencing: 29 April 2024.

(U23222 Foxhill Lane, Bromsgrove) (Temporary Closure) Order 2024

Order made: To close that part of U23222 Foxhill Lane from its junction with C2173 Wheeley Road to its

junction with C2001 Scarfield Hill.

Reason: Install 8 carriageway spillways and investigate blocked gully by WCC.

Exemptions: To permit access to any land or premises fronting the highway affected where there is no other form of access; and to allow the works to be undertaken.

Alternative route: C2001 Scarfield Hill, U22400 Cobley Hill, C2173 Wheeley Road and vice versa. Maximum duration: 18 Months. Anticipated duration: 5 days. Commencing: 8 April 2024.
